This presentation describes the strategic need for the wind energy industry to pursue coopetition as a core strategy for decarbonization and deployment. It highlights several mechanisms for coopetition including open source software, open standards, joint ventures and Co-innovation. This was presented at the Consortium for Energy and Data Science at Texas A&M University on March 29, 2023.
